Am 11.10.2017 um 17:50 schrieb SuStel:
> but here we're not expected to think of this as /many (different) 
> electricities./ I don't think *Do law'* would automatically mean /many 
> (different) velocities/ just by that logical alone.

I don't have canon examples at hand, but I'm sure that {law'} is not 
only "many" but also "much" (bIQ law' - "a lot of water", not "many 
waters"). So with noncountable things like {'ul law'} I don't read it as 
"many electricities", but "much electricity".

> Now that we have *vItlh,* that's obviously the better choice for things 
> like this. But you can't completely rule out using *law'.*

I think one can use this to distinguish between "a lot of speed, very 
fast {Do law'} and "a high amount of speed measured in numbers" {Do vItlh}.
